## Key Capabilities

- **Cost-Based Query Optimization**: `EXPLAIN (ANALYZE, BUFFERS, VERBOSE)`, join strategies (Hash Join, Merge Join, Nested Loop).
- **Index Engineering**: B-Tree, BRIN, GIN/GiST, covering indexes (`INCLUDE`), partial indexes, HNSW vector indexing (`pgvector`).
- **Zero-Downtime Migrations**: Non-blocking DDL (`CREATE INDEX CONCURRENTLY`, safe column adds, phased backfills).
- **Concurrency & Isolation**: MVCC snapshot isolation, repeatable read anomalies, row-level locks (`SELECT ... FOR UPDATE SKIP LOCKED`).
- **Scale & Partitioning**: Declarative range/hash partitioning, connection pooling (PgBouncer), read replicas, CDC replication.
